Methods' Details |
getTargetBackend
- Description
- gets the target backend for importing.
- Returns
- the Backend into which layers are
imported by
|
|
setTargetBackend
- Description
- sets the target backend for importing.
- Parameter aBackend
- a Backend into which layers should be
imported by XLayerImporter::importLayer().
- Throws
- com::sun::star::lang::NullPointerException
if the backend passed is NULL.
|
|
importLayer
- Description
- Imports the layer given into the backend.
This method imports data for the current entity of the backend.
- Parameter aLayer
- a layer whose data will be imported into the backend
- Throws
- com::sun::star::lang::NullPointerException
if the layer passed is NULL or no backend is available.
- Throws
- com::sun::star::configuration::backend::MalformedDataException
if the layer passed is invalid
- Throws
- com::sun::star::lang::IllegalArgumentException
if the layer passed is for a component
that doesn't exist in the backend
- Throws
- com::sun::star::lang::WrappedTargetException
if an error occurs in the backend or source layer.
- See also
- XBackend::getOwnUpdateHandler()
|
|
importLayerForEntity
- Description
- Imports the layer given into the backend for a given entity.
This method imports data for the current entity of the backend.
- Parameter aLayer
- a layer whose data will be imported into the backend
- Parameter aEntity
- a entity into whose data the layer will be imported
- Throws
- com::sun::star::lang::NullPointerException
if the layer passed is NULL or no backend is available.
- Throws
- com::sun::star::configuration::backend::MalformedDataException
if the layer passed is invalid
- Throws
- com::sun::star::lang::IllegalArgumentException
if the layer passed is for a component
that doesn't exist in the backend
or if the entity doesn't exist in the backend.
- Throws
- com::sun::star::lang::WrappedTargetException
if an error occurs in the backend or source layer.
- See also
- XBackend::getUpdateHandler()
|
|
Top of Page
Copyright © 2012, The Apache Software Foundation, Licensed under the Apache License, Version 2.0. Apache, the Apache feather logo, Apache OpenOffice and OpenOffice.org are trademarks of The Apache Software Foundation. Other names may be trademarks of their respective owners.